Season Dates and General Information

A legal Dall Sheep ram has to be full curl on at least one side, broken on both sides, or at least 8 years old. Dall Sheep season runs from August 10th to September 20th. Cold temperatures and snow often arrive early at higher elevations. August and early September dates are recommended for dall sheep hunts.  Moose season runs from August 20th – Sept. 25th.  There is no closed season for brown bear in most of my concession.

NOTE: A person who has been airborne may not take or assist in taking big game until after 3:00 a.m. following the day in which the flight occurred. For this reason, clients should try to arrive a day or two early and leave a day or two later than actual trip dates.

DALL SHEEP OR GRIZZLY?? : In most cases, the chance of seeing brown or grizzly bears on a sheep hunt is about 50%. If you also have a keen interest in brown/grizzly bears, you should purchase an extra tag in advance, and not pass up the chance if you get one. Or if you feel you can only afford one animal, you could purchase a brown/grizzly tag instead of a sheep tag. Tags work for species of equal or lesser value. Purchasing a grizzly tag for $1000.00 versus a sheep tag for $850.00, would allow a sheep hunter to shoot a grizzly instead of a sheep, if he ran into a nice one before harvesting his ram, or near the end of his hunt and he hadn’t harvested a ram yet and time is running out. If you kill a brown/grizzly bear first and want to keep hunting for sheep, the same prices and conditions under the Brown or Grizzly Bear Add On section, would apply.

INCIDENTAL SPECIES: Free incidental Black Bear or wolverine and multiple wolves contingent upon open seasons. “Incidental” means that we don’t move to or specifically hunt for them, but if we run across one and can take it without messing up your sheep hunt, you can. You must purchase any necessary tags in advance.  Wolf tags aren’t required by non residents in my concession area. A black bear tag will work for either black bear or wolverine.
